Chyron Unreal Engine-Based PRIME VSAR 2.1 is Entry-Level Virtual Production That Adds NDI and Camera Tracking

chyron

Chyron has released PRIME VSAR 2.1, the latest version of its Unreal Engine-based virtual set and augmented reality (AR) engine designed for producers and daily news productions. This release brings compatibility with Unreal Engine 5.4, nDisplay, NDI streams, and IP-based camera tracking protocols, making it easier than ever to deliver engaging virtual and hybrid productions.

With integration for Unreal Engine 5.4 and Unreal nDisplay, PRIME VSAR 2.1 enables producers to display virtual content across ultra-large or non-standard LED walls using multiple stitched outputs. Combined with PRIME VSAR’s internal Cesium camera tracking, the system generates realistic parallax effects on LED walls using real studio camera movement.

Version 2.1 introduces hybrid tracking functionality, allowing seamless switching between tracked and trackless cameras within a virtual set—even between cameras using different tracking systems. These transitions are interpolated to create smooth, dynamic scene changes and engaging storytelling possibilities.

Other enhancements include NDI inputs and outputs for virtual production and expanded support for IP-based camera tracking protocols, reinforcing PRIME VSAR 2.1’s place as a go-to platform for flexible and modern virtual production workflows.
